Buffalo Chicken Grilled Cheese Sandwiches

  1. Heat a skillet over medium heat, melt 2 tbsp of butter, and add the chicken.
  2. Season with salt and pepper, and cook for about 4 minutes on each side until it's cooked completely.
  3. Transfer to a plate, and shred the chicken using two forks.
  4. Add 2 tbsp of butter to the same pan, then add the chicken back and the Frank's.
  5. Mix well, and cook for a minute until heated through.
  6. To assemble the sandwiches, start with 2 slices of bread, butter one side of the first piece and place butter side down in a frying pan.
  7. Place the cheddar cheese on the bread, then the mozzarella, then the blue cheese.
  8. Spoon the chicken over the cheeses, then top with the other piece of bread, butter side facing up.
  9. Grill over medium heat until golden on both sides, and all cheese is melted.
  10. Dip sandwiches in ranch dressing.
